Subject: Re: [wsrp] navigational state change
"The Consumer SHOULD supply this value as the navigationalState on the subsequent invocations for this use of the Portlet for at least the duration of the End-User's interactions with this aggregated page in order to maintain End-User state. The Consumer is not required to persist the navigationalState for longer than this set of interactions, but can provide such a persistence if desired." On your question on direct vs indirect, I don't understand why a portlet can't encode new navState in a URL during a getMarkup?
